
9.0 Accessories
9.1 Window Air Purge Assembly
This assembly installs around the optical window to protect it from air borne contaminants. Air is
connected via the ¼ inch (6mm) pipefitting and a sintered insert disperses the air around the optical
window.
Clean, dry, oil free air at 2-3 psig < 5 scfm should be connected. Only a nominal supply is required, high
airflow in the tube tends to create a vortex and actually sucks dust into the tube.
9.2 Product Loss Sensors
These are photoelectric proximity sensors that mount to the sensor. They “sense” the presence of the
product under the sensor. When the product disappears they provide an input contact to the HOLD input
in the sensor, to freeze the sensor’s readings and analog outputs until the product returns.
9.3 Network Interfaces
The sensor may be fitted with a variety of interface modules that provide the sensor’s output data in the
correct format for the network into which it is operating. Refer to the instructions provided with each
option module for installation and output formats.
9.4 Cooling Panels
The MCT series sensors may be fitted with a cooling panel to allow the sensor to be installed in
environments where the temperature is greater than 50 C (120 F).
The cooling panel is mounted on the bottom face of the sensor and may be used with either water or air-
cooling media.
When used with air-cooling a Vortec Cooling Element will be provided. This element provides a stream
of cold air to the panel.
The requirements for either cooling media are as follows:
9.4.1 Air Cooling
Connect the Vortec cooling element to the inlet port on the cooling panel.
Connect a ¼” (6mm) inlet tube to the inlet of the cooler element.
Supply clean, dry air at 80 – 100psi (6-7 bars) to the cooler.
9.4.2 Water Cooling
Connect a ¼: (6mm) tube to the inlet and outlet connectors on the cooling panel.
Supply cold water (65-80F/20-27C) at an approximate flow rate of 1cfm (0.3 liters/min).
